#ADD81C Hex Color Code

#ADD81C

The Hexadecimal Color #ADD81C is a contrast shade of Yellow Green. #ADD81C RGB value is rgb(173, 216, 28). RGB Color Model of #ADD81C consists of 67% red, 84% green and 10% blue. HSL color Mode of #ADD81C has 74°(degrees) Hue, 77% Saturation and 48% Lightness. #ADD81C color has an wavelength of 573.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#ADD81C is #CCFF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#ADD81C is #AD2. The Closest Color to #ADD81C is #9ACD32. Official Name of #ADD81C Hex Code is Bahia.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#ADD81C is 20 Cyan 0 Magenta 87 Yellow 15 Black and #ADD81C CMY is 20, 0, 87.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#ADD81C is hsl(74,77,48,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(74, 87,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#ADD81C is 42.0, 58.08, 10.1.
Hex8 Value of #ADD81C is #ADD81CFF. Decimal Value of #ADD81C is 11393052 and Octal Value of #ADD81C is 53354034. Binary Value of #ADD81C is 10101101, 11011000, 11100 and Android of #ADD81C is 4289583132 / 0xffadd81c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#ADD81C is 0.381, 0.527, 0.527 and YIQ Color Space of #ADD81C is 181.711, 34.7807, -67.6001.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#ADD81C is 54.09, 69.1, 10.85.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#ADD81C is 80.78, -36.33, 76.33.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#ADD81C is 80.78, -20.77, 89.97.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#ADD81C is 80.78, 84.53, 115.45. Hunter Lab variable of #ADD81C is 76.21, -35.0, 45.49.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#ADD81C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
